Joan (Joann) Hood Wiseman, 84, passed away surrounded by her loving family and grandchildren on August 17, 2014. The oldest of five children, Joan was born on July 11, 1930 in Cement, OKLA to Jewell O. Reece and Simon F. Hood. As a young woman, Joan traveled to California where she soon met her future husband, Mort Wiseman. They were married on July 16, 1951 and made their home in Las Vegas, NV. Joan worked for many years at the Flamingo hotel and later the Hilton hotel, first as a hostess and later as the manager of the coffee shop. She made many life-long friendships during those years. Her husband Mort, passed away on Dec. 29, 1990 after a long battle with diabetes. In 1991, Joan became a member of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-Day Saints. She found much joy and happiness in service to others. Joan was a member of the Relief Society Presidency as well as holding many other callings. She enjoyed sharing her conversion story and her faith in Jesus Christ. She touched the lives of many people who loved her dearly. Joan was a resident of Las Vegas for 50 years. In her later years as her health declined, she moved to Utah to be closer to her daughter and grandchildren. Joan had a special love for children and delighted in being around them. Her grandchildren and her great-grandchildren were her whole world. They always brought a sparkle to her eyes and joy to her face when she held them. Joan loved knitting and crocheting and created many beautiful pieces for others. She was a "do it yourself" gal who always "made do" with what she had and her home always looked beautiful. One of Joan's defining attributes was gratitude. She always took the time to make you feel special and showered you with appreciation for everything.
